World's Largest Value-Priced Golf Equipment and Accessories Supplier Upgrades with TECSYS to Manage Acquisitions and 20% Annual Growth

MONTREAL, June 30, 2004 — TECSYS Inc. (TSE: TCS), a leading Supply Chain Management (SCM) software provider announced today that King Par Corporation, the world's largest value-priced golf equipment and accessories supplier upgraded to its EliteSeries Release 7.2. TECSYS' enterprise suite of applications will provide King Par with the technological edge, strategic processes and information to meet and exceed the company's ever-growing and complex worldwide distribution requirements.

"Even though we have been a TECSYS user since 1999, our acquisitions and the increasing demands of customers prompted us to review the market to determine the best fit for our company," remarked Kelly Harrison, IT Director at King Par Corporation. "After a thorough search, we determined that the latest version of TECSYS' application suite, EliteSeries 7.2, has constantly evolved to meet and exceed the demands of the industry." Harrison continued, "TECSYS' knowledge of the distribution market and the latest enhancements in version 7.2 of the EliteSeries allow us to easily track and cost inbound shipments, and since EliteSeries 7.2 is Web-based, it allows us to easily connect our other divisions and remote salespeople."

King Par Corporation recently purchased the Orlimar Golf Company, which was one of the factors that prompted the company to initiate a search for a new solution. Orlimar was using MAS 90, and King Par was using EliteSeries 6.3. The company also wanted to be able to connect remote offices and their 60 remote sales representatives, so that they could use a single application. With King Par's latest acquisition, Asia had also become more prominent in the mix and, as a result, being able to handle container costs became critical. Container tracking allows King Par to capture the actual costs, regardless of whether the container is comprised of multiple purchase orders and/or multiple vendors. Since each container can have different taxes, freight, duty, handling and other associated costs in local or foreign currencies, King Par will know exactly what the actual cost of goods sold is. With minimal effort, the actual gross margin and profitability of each item is known. King Par is scheduled to go live with EliteSeries 7.2 in September 2004. The company is headquartered in Flushing, Michigan, and has warehouses in Flint, Michigan, and Brea, California.

About King Par Corporation

King Par Corporation is a thirty-year-old golf company that specializes in golf equipment and accessories. King Par develops and distributes several "make up/private label" projects including the Ti-Tech program for Wal-Mart, the Stonehouse program for Dick's Sporting Goods, the Golf Master program for JJB Sports, and the Stellar program for the National Golf Buyers Association. Recent awards for vendor of the year include: The Sports Authority 1999, and Shopko Stores 1999 and 2000. The wholesale distribution operation owns several brands of golf club lines, including Knight, Affinity, Fortune, Strategy, private labels, and Intech, a golf accessory line, all of which have a unique target market orientation. King Par is the largest single-store supplier for TaylorMade merchandise. For more information, please visit www.kingpar.com.

About TECSYS

TECSYS is a leading Supply Chain Management software company that provides powerful enterprise distribution software solutions through three divisions. 1) EliteSeries SCM software suite focuses on mid-to-large healthcare distribution and logistics companies (pharmaceuticals/medical/surgical distributors and integrated delivery networks), along with key segments in general wholesale distribution. EliteSeries' modules include Enterprise Performance Management, Distribution Management, Warehouse Management, Transportation Management, and E-Commerce. 2) PointForce distribution software suite focuses on the giftware industry, along with office products distribution and other small-to-medium importer/distributors. 3) TECSYS Transportation System provides a state-of-the-art multi-carrier solution for parcel and LTL management. The company's customers include about 600 small and medium size and Fortune 1000 companies. TECSYS' shares are listed on the Toronto Stock Exchange (TSX) under the ticker symbol TCS.
